linux系统中oracle重启命令

不及物动词 其他 13

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ux系统中,可以使用以下命令来重启Oracle数据库:

    1. 使用root或者具有sudo权限的用户登录到Linux系统。
    2. 打开终端,使用以下命令切换到Oracle用户:
    “`
    su – oracle
    “`
    3. 进入到Oracle的安装目录,一般是`$ORACLE_HOME`。可以使用以下命令切换到Oracle的安装目录:
    “`
    cd $ORACLE_HOME
    “`
    4. 执行Oracle的启动脚本以关闭数据库实例:
    “`
    ./bin/dbshut
    “`
    这个命令将会关闭数据库实例和监听器。
    5. 确保数据库实例和监听器已经成功关闭后,可以使用以下命令重新启动Oracle数据库:
    “`
    ./bin/dbstart
    “`
    这个命令将会启动数据库实例和监听器。

    注意:以上命令是Oracle安装目录的默认路径,如果你的Oracle安装目录不同,请根据实际情况进行调整。

    此外,还可以使用Oracle的控制台工具`sqlplus`来重启数据库。步骤如下:

    1. 使用root或者具有sudo权限的用户登录到Linux系统。
    2. 打开终端,使用以下命令切换到Oracle用户:
    “`
    su – oracle
    “`
    3. 打开Oracle的控制台工具 `sqlplus`:
    “`
    sqlplus / as sysdba
    “`
    这个命令将会以管理员身份登录到Oracle数据库。
    4. 在`sqlplus`中执行以下命令关闭数据库实例:
    “`
    shutdown immediate;
    “`
    这个命令将会关闭数据库实例。
    5. 确保数据库实例已经成功关闭后,执行以下命令重新启动数据库实例:
    “`
    startup;
    “`
    这个命令将会启动数据库实例。

    以上就是在Linux系统中重启Oracle数据库的命令。根据实际情况选择使用其中的一种方法即可。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ux系统中,可以使用以下命令来重启Oracle数据库:

    1. 使用sqlplus工具登录到数据库:sqlplus / as sysdba

    2. 在sqlplus命令行界面中,输入以下命令来关闭数据库:shutdown immediate;

    3. 等待数据库关闭完成后,输入以下命令来启动数据库:startup;

    4. 如果想要在重启过程中进行数据库备份,可以使用以下命令来启动数据库,并同时执行备份操作:startup backup;

    5. 确保在执行重启命令之前备份了数据库,以免数据丢失或损坏。

    需要注意的是,这些命令需要在具有适当权限的账户下运行,例如Oracle的超级管理员账户(sysdba)。另外,确保在执行重启命令之前保存了所有未保存的数据和更改,以免丢失。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Linux系统中,Oracle数据库的重启可以通过以下几个步骤进行:

    1. 查看数据库状态:在终端中使用以下命令查看数据库的状态。

    “`
    $ sqlplus / as sysdba
    SQL> select status from v$instance;
    “`

    如果数据库的状态为”OPEN”,则表示数据库已经启动,可以进行下一步的重启操作;如果状态为”STARTED”或者”MOUNTED”,则需要先将数据库关闭。

    2. 关闭数据库:如果数据库处于启动状态,可以使用以下命令关闭数据库。

    “`
    SQL> shutdown immediate;
    “`

    这个命令会立即关闭数据库,并且断开所有用户的连接。如果有正在进行的事务,则会等待事务完成或者回滚。

    3. 停止监听器:在终端中使用以下命令停止监听器。

    “`
    $ lsnrctl stop
    “`

    这个命令会停止Oracle监听器,使得数据库无法通过监听器接受连接请求。

    4. 启动监听器:在终端中使用以下命令启动监听器,确保数据库能够接受连接请求。

    “`
    $ lsnrctl start
    “`

    5. 启动数据库:在终端中使用以下命令启动数据库。

    “`
    SQL> startup;
    “`

    这个命令会启动数据库,并且连接监听器。

    6. 验证数据库状态:可以再次使用以下命令验证数据库的状态。

    “`
    SQL> select status from v$instance;
    “`

    如果状态显示为”OPEN”,则表示数据库已经成功启动。

    这些步骤可以让你在Linux系统中对Oracle数据库进行重启。注意,在重启数据库之前,建议先备份数据库以防止数据丢失。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部